Product belongs to the TMS320DM644x, DaVinci series. Type: Digital Media System-on-Chip (DMSoC) Tray is the packaging method for this product 361-LFBGA Operational temperature range: 0°C ~ 85°C (TC) Surface Mount mounting type Interface: ASP, EBI/EMI, Host Interface, I2C, SPI, UART, USB Supplier device package: 361-NFBGA (13x13) Clock rate is 594MHz DSP, 297MHz ARMR . 160kB of on-chip RAM 1.8V, 3.3V voltage I/O Operating voltage of 1.20V
